A Graduate Certificate in Design Patterns for Virtual Reality (VR) equips students with the advanced skills necessary to design and develop immersive and interactive VR experiences. The program focuses on best practices and proven design patterns within the VR development landscape, ensuring graduates are prepared for immediate contributions to the industry.
Learning outcomes include a deep understanding of user interface (UI) and user experience (UX) principles specific to VR, proficiency in various VR development tools and platforms, and the ability to implement efficient and scalable design solutions. Students will learn to leverage 3D modeling, animation, and interaction design techniques to create compelling VR applications.
The duration of the certificate program typically ranges from 6 to 12 months, depending on the institution and the number of courses required. The curriculum is often structured flexibly to accommodate working professionals' schedules, offering both online and on-campus options.
This graduate certificate holds significant industry relevance. The rapidly expanding virtual reality sector demands professionals skilled in designing intuitive and engaging VR applications. Graduates are well-positioned for roles in game development, architecture visualization, medical training simulations, and more. The program's focus on established design patterns ensures graduates are equipped with practical, immediately applicable skills, making them highly sought-after candidates.
Furthermore, knowledge of human-computer interaction (HCI) principles and 360-degree video production are often integrated into the curriculum, enhancing the overall learning experience and preparing students for the multifaceted nature of VR development projects.
